The degree of “imperfect mixing” induced by the macro mixing in the turbulent eddy scale is estimated by evaluating the probability density function versus the equivalence ratio.
The procedure was proposed to evaluate the simplified discrete probability density function based on the measured average gas concentrations. The patterns of probability density function for three typical turbulent diffusion flames, with and without swirl, are presented to characterize the degree of imperfect mixing depending on the flame configurations and positions in the flame.
